MARINA RAJCIC<br />

goalkeeper<br />

• Podgorica-born 23-year-old made her professional handball debut at 16 with Buducnost,<br />

one year later was voted ‘best young Montenegrin player’ & at 18 was the youngest handball<br />

player at the London 2012 Olympics<br />

• For a relatively young keeper has vast experience playing at top level for both club and country:<br />

7 CL seasons, 7 <strong>EURO</strong>, Wch & OG competitions<br />

• Could earn her 100 th international cap at <strong>EURO</strong> 2016 (currently on 95)<br />

• Sister of Olivera Vukcevic with whom she also played her club handball at Metz<br />

OG: S 2012, <strong>EURO</strong>: G 2012<br />

EC trophies: CL 2012, 2015; Cup Winners’ Cup 2010<br />

MAJDA MEHMEDOVIC<br />

left wing<br />

marina_rajcic<br />

• Her mother played handball as a goalkeeper; Majda started playing in Bar at 12 along<br />

with her brother Musa<br />

• Has scored over 230 goals in her 100 caps for Montenegro<br />

• Voted onto the CL All-star team 2013/14 as best left wing<br />

• Suffered from a very severe neck injury ahead of the CL Final in 2012<br />

OG: S 2012; <strong>EURO</strong>: G 2012<br />

EC trophies: CL 2012, 2015; Cup Winners’ Cup: 2010<br />

DJURDJINA JAUKOVIC<br />

left back<br />

majdam77<br />

• At 19 she is considered one of the major up-and-coming talents in Montenegrin handball<br />

• Twice was voted ‘best young player’ (2014 & 2015) in Montenegro<br />

• Top scorer and MVP of Women’s 19 EHF <strong>EURO</strong> 2015 in Spain (71 goals)<br />

• Scored 31 goals in 9 games at 2015 WCh in Denmark in her debut tournament at senior level<br />

MILENA RAICEVIC<br />

centre back<br />

• Two-time Montenegrin player of the year (2009, 2012)<br />

• At EHF <strong>EURO</strong> 2012 had most assists (29) and shared second place in scoring with Anita<br />

Görbicz (41 goals)<br />

• Best left back at Junior World Handball <strong>Champ</strong>ionship 2010<br />

• Sister of professional football player Ivan Knezevic<br />

OG: S 2012; EHF <strong>EURO</strong>: G 2012<br />

EC trophies: CL 2015; Cup Winners’ Cup 2010<br />
